2. Professional Masterclasses do NOT require advanced registration –> Four masterclasses open to SoJam attendees! Masterclasses hosted by Claude McKnight, Basix, Sonos, and Overboard are focused on particular groups but open to an audience of all interested SoJam attendees.

3. “Serious Business” Registration –> Mark Hines is leading a workshop on Serious Business at 7:15am this Saturday. This special workshop is limited to 15 students and requires advance registration. If you would like to take advantage of this unique opportunity, contact SoJam educational officer Benjamin Stevens no later than Wednesday at 9:00pm EST.

4. Open Information Session – All attendees are invited to a general information session at 8:30am Saturday in Page Auditorium. This session will orient attendees to SoJam and to the Duke University campus before leading into registration and the first full workshop session at 9:00am.

5. Parking at Duke University –> Parking is located off of Science Drive next to the Bryan Center (as indicated on the map), and is $5 per car for the day.

6. Masterclass Schedule Finalized – Masterclass schedule will be ready for release to groups tonight or Wednesday.

7. Registration and Will Call –> Registration will be open from 5pm to 7:30pm at the Carolina Theatre on Friday, Nov. 12th.  Any registrations not picked up before the competition begins will be available at the will call table Friday evening or at the info table on Saturday morning. Your Paypal receipt or email confirmation is your proof of payment, so be sure to print it out and bring it with you.
